Output d23dbdb7618f61e398ef3d206ac98c357c1c153ab2bb0a242e8520bf350af40d: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b553f98da56eed48680a3665dab8652fb877c4 OP_EQUAL
address
35JyVvA4fMnSzrS6gVPgJQaeE72hQz6544
transaction
d23dbdb7618f61e398ef3d206ac98c357c1c153ab2bb0a242e8520bf350af40d
confirmations
250928
spent
true